Stainless steel seamless pipe, literally meaning that the surface of the stainless steel material does not have welded seams.
In terms of usage, it can be roughly divided into industrial pipes and sanitary pipes. Most of the time, stainless steel seamless pipes refer to industrial grade stainless steel seamless pipes, as they are widely used in industrial production and infrastructure projects.
There is also a significant difference in appearance between the two. The surface of seamless industrial pipes is generally a solid solution surface (also known as an annealed face), while the surface of seamless sanitary pipes is a polished mirror surface.
There are also significant differences in production processes between the two. Industrial seamless pipes are produced by two bundle rolling mills or lathes.
Production process of industrial stainless steel seamless pipe: smelting steel ingot - rolling into elemental steel - stripping and perforation of elemental steel - pipe quenching - pipe quenching, annealing, washing, repairing, grinding and coating - cold drawing by lathe/rolling mill - annealing, washing, cleaning - quality inspection and packaging.
Common materials include: 201304304L, 321316L, 310S, 22052507254SMO, 347H, 904L
The product implementation standards include: GB/T14976, GB/T13296, American ASTM A312, ASTMA213, Japanese JIS, German DIN and other standards
Stainless steel seamless pipes have a wide range of applications, mainly used for fluid and gas transportation, as well as for various machined parts.
